Parking Brake Valve Module May Cause Rollaway
A parking brake that is not engaged as expected when the driver releases the brakes may allow the vehicle to rollaway, increasing the risk of crash.

Summary
Nikola Corporation (Nikola) is recalling certain 2022-2024 TRE BEV trucks. The electronic parking brake valve module (PVM) may fail to move into the park position when the parking brake is activated.
Remedy
Dealers will replace the PVM, free of charge. Owner notification letters are expected to be mailed May 1, 2023. Owners may contact Nikola customer service at 1-630-808-4531. Nikola’s number for this recall is 23VDC0301.

Chronology :
3/16/23 Nikola Vehicle Defect Technical Team (VDTT) was informed that Bendix
issued a recall (23E-015) for the Intellipark PVM used in Nikola vehicles. Nikola VDTT launched an investigation with the engineering team.
3/17/23–3/28/23 Nikola worked with Bendix
to determine design, cause, and possible corrective actions.
Vehicle population determined.
3/28/23 After investigation, Nikola Vehicle Defect Technical Team voted to recommend issue to Nikola Vehicle Defects Committee.
4/06/23 Nikola Vehicle Defect Committee determined that a safety-related defect exists and to issue a voluntary recall.

SUBJECT
Bendix
Intellipark PVM Interim Corrective Action
Issue Date: 4/24/2023
OVERVIEW
Nikola Corporation has submitted a safety recall (number 23VDC0301) regarding the Bendix
Intellipark Tractor Park Valve Module (PVM) defect (recall number 23V-249) that affects Nikola Tre BEV models built between 11/05/2021 and 04/05/2023. Nikola Corporation will communicate corrective actions once a remedy is available. In the meantime, please follow the below instructions to properly activate the parking brake and prevent vehicle roll-away.
PROCEDURE
Note: If abnormal Intellipark brake switch LED operation is observed, do the following procedures.
Note: Repeat these procedures each time the truck is parked.
Parking the Truck
1. Fan the truck brakes as follows:
a. If a trailer is connected, pull the Trailer Air Supply Brake switch (1) to evacuate its air and apply/set the trailer brakes.
b. Push in the Truck Parking Brake switch (2) to release the parking brakes.
c. Pump the brake pedal until the system air pressure drops to under 60 psi (413.7 kPa).
Note: The “BRAKE” telltale lamp/warning message will appear, and air pressure gauge color will change to RED on the cluster display.
PSW-WI-ICA001 Page | 2
Rev 0
PROCEDURE
d. Continue to pump the brake pedal until the system air pressure drops below 5 psi (34.5 kPa).
Note: The “BRAKE” telltale lamp/warning message will continue to appear, and an audible alert will sound.
e. Without pressing the brake pedal, press the START / STOP button once to transition the truck into the OFF mode.
2. Place wheel chocks on the truck’s tag axle wheels.
Upon Restarting the Truck
1. Remove the wheel chocks from the truck’s tag axle wheels.
2. While pressing the brake pedal, press the START / STOP button once to transition the truck into the ON / Standby mode.
3. Allow the E-compressor to run until the truck’s air system pressure is above 155 psi (1068.7 kPa).
4. Continue with standard operation.

PROCEDURE
Brake Air System Bleed
1. Place wheel chocks on the truck’s tag axle wheels.
2. Fan the truck brakes as follows:
a. If a trailer is connected, pull the Trailer Air Supply Brake
switch (1) to evacuate its air and apply/set the trailer brakes.
b. Push in the Truck Parking Brake switch (2) to release the
parking brakes.
c. Pump the brake pedal until the system air pressure drops to
under 60 psi (413.7 kPa).
Note: The “BRAKE” telltale lamp/warning message will
appear, and air pressure gauge color will change to
RED on the cluster display.
Nikola Corporation —Proprietary & Confidential Printed copies of this document must be verified for current revision – Ref:
PSW-WI-TBR0001 Rev: 2, Printed: 5/11/2023 Page 2 of 8
WORK INSTRUCTIONS
PSW-WI-TBR0001 Page | 3
Rev 2
PROCEDURE
d. Continue to pump the brake pedal until the system air
pressure drops below 5 psi (34.5 kPa).
Note: The “BRAKE” telltale lamp/warning message will
continue to appear, and an audible alert will sound.
e. Without pressing the brake pedal, press the
START / STOP button once to transition the truck into the OFF
mode.

PROCEDURE
Parking Brake Valve Module Removal
1. Use the manual battery disconnect (MBD) to disconnect the
vehicle’s electrical system.
2. Locate the PVM (1) at the rear of the truck, installed above the
E-axle.
3. Remove the four air hoses (1) from the PVM.
Note: Mark the air hoses for ease of installation.
Nikola Corporation —Proprietary & Confidential Printed copies of this document must be verified for current revision – Ref:
PSW-WI-TBR0001 Rev: 2, Printed: 5/11/2023 Page 4 of 8
WORK INSTRUCTIONS
PSW-WI-TBR0001 Page | 5
Rev 2
PROCEDURE
4. Remove the four electrical connectors (1) from the PVM.
Note: Mark the electrical connectors for ease of installation.
5. Remove the three nuts (1) from the three bolts (2).
6. Remove the three bolts (2) from the PVM (3).
7. Remove the PVM (3) from the truck.
8. Locate the label (2) and record the serial number from the
removed PVM (1).
Note: The serial number will be a five-digit number (A) found on
the label (2)
9. Record the vehicle mileage.

PROCEDURE
Parking Brake Valve Module Installation
1. Check and make sure the PVM (1) being installed has a
cable tie (2) installed as seen in the figure.
Note: Do not remove the cable tie. The cable tie identifies the
newly updated PVM.
2. Locate the label (2) and record the serial number from the new
PVM (1).
Note: The serial number will be a five-digit number (A) found on
the label (2)
3. Position the PVM (3) into place on the truck.
4. Install the three bolts (2) into the PVM (3).
5. Install the three nuts (1) onto the three bolts (2).
6. Use a torque wrench to torque the three bolts (2) to
175 ± 25 lb-in (20 ± 3 N·m).

PROCEDURE
7. Install the four electrical connectors (1) to the PVM.
Note: Make sure the four electrical connectors are installed in
the correct location as marked during removal.
8. Install the four air hoses (1) to the PVM.
Note: Make sure the four air hoses are installed in the correct
location as marked during removal.

PROCEDURE
9. Use the MBD to reconnect the vehicle’s electrical system.
10. While pressing the brake pedal, press the START / STOP button
once to transition the truck into the ON / Standby mode.
11. Check the brake system air pressure as follows:
a. Allow the E-compressor to build initial air pressure to
179 ± 1 psi (1234 ± 6.9 kPa).
Note: Pressure will drop and hold at approximately
165 psi (1137.6 kPa). This is normal.
b. Press the brake pedal and keep applying pressure for one
minute.
c. Check and make sure no more than 3 psi (20.7 kPa) have
been lost.
PROCEDURE IS COMPLETE

Description of the Defect : The Bendix
Intellipark Tractor Park Valve Module (PVM) may intermittently become stuck in the un-parked position and may not transition from un-parked to parked when the Park Switch is pulled on the vehicle dash board. Bendix
informed Nikola that they issued an equipment recall (23E-015) for this issue.
FMVSS 1 : NR FMVSS 2 : NR
Description of the Safety Risk : An Intellipark PVM that intermittently becomes stuck in the un-parked
position does not allow the vehicle spring brakes to exhaust when the driver pulls the Park Switch. The vehicle must be parked by depleting air storage by fanning-down the air brake system with the service brake pedal. If a driver does detect the Intellipark PVM malfunction indications and does not properly fan down the brakes, the vehicle may unintentionally move which increases the likelihood of a crash. Description of the Cause : Mechanical components in the PVM that are at the upper limit of the design Part 573 Safety Recall Report 23V-249 Page 2 Identification of Any Warning
that can Occur : specification and other tolerance stack-ups allow for excessive internal air leakage. The internal leakage does not allow pressure to build properly when the pilot solenoid is activated.
Park Indication LEDs on the park switch remain off after the Park Switch is pulled indicating that the spring brake system has not exhausted and the vehicle is not parked. Audible exhaust sounds that typically are heard as an airbraked vehicle is parked will not be heard indicating that the vehicle has not parked. Involved Components : Component Name 1 : Bendix
